Syllabus
<p>Under Comp. Laws, $ 3524, providing that-“a voluntary acceptance of the benefit of a transaction is equivalent to a consent to all the obligations arising from it, so far as the facts are known or ought to be known to the person accepting,’’ a corporation which accepts the benefit of an agreement executed in its behalf by one of its officers, extending a mortgage on its property, and containing a provision by which it assumed liability for the debt secured,.is bound by such provision, regardless of the question of the officer’s original authority to execute such agreement.</p>
